Apia (APW) to Bajawa (BJW) Flight Distance
The flight distance from Faleolo International Airport (APW) in Apia, Samoa to Soa Airport (BJW) in Bajawa, Indonesia is 7,300 kilometers (4,536 miles / 3,942 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 10h, flying west at a heading of 267°.
